Output 51debe9e6f282de89e79a0598259e8231103b7ecd34025f896b58358d6332d02:0

value
258597814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a8f95c28221f15f47b93f24278e88e025e5c23 OP_EQUAL
address
35VJ3w38jEA4dDMTAyinuQVhkkFyGRKdQN
transaction
51debe9e6f282de89e79a0598259e8231103b7ecd34025f896b58358d6332d02
spent
true